Us Insurance, Medicare Tariffs Sink the Securities

Summary by Il Sole 24 Ore
Nearly $90 billion in stock market capitalization burned in a few hours. That's how much they lost, in the late afternoon of yesterday, the main U.S. health insurance companies.
